The 59th National MATTA Fair 2026 has opened at the Malaysia International Trade and Exhibition Centre (MITEC) to kick-start the exhibition of international travel deals and holiday packages.

This fair is opportune for Malaysia to boost its tourism. The impressive travel statistics for 2020 may be cited here for context. Research has shown that 42.2 million international visits were recorded compared to a previous year’s record of 37.5 million which is a notable increase by 11.2% already, and for the first 6 months of 2026, an incredible 21.2 million international visits have occurred.

The Visit Malaysia 2026 campaign is the backbone of the significant targets set for this year end (2026) by the nation.

Advertisement

47 million international tourist arrivals and a total of RM147.1 billion in expected tourism income have been set.

Regional Pride and Global Reach

Adding a magnificent layer of local pride to the event, the exhibition features 12 State Tourism Organisations (STOs) from all across Malaysia.

These STOs are working tirelessly to highlight the hidden gems and celebrated landmarks within their respective borders.

From the mystical rainforests of Borneo to the historic streets of Penang, and from the pristine beaches of Terengganu to the bustling cultural hubs of Johor, the STOs are ensuring that domestic tourism remains a powerful pillar of the national economy.

Simultaneously, the Fair boasts an incredibly impressive international presence, featuring 16 National Tourism Organisations (NTOs) from around the world.

These NTOs bring the allure of foreign lands directly to Kuala Lumpur, offering Malaysians a literal passport to global adventures. Taking absolute centre stage in this global pavilion is Taiwan, which has been immensely honoured as this edition’s International Favourite Destination.

Taiwan’s prominent placement highlights its vibrant night markets, stunning mountainous terrain, and deep historical resonance, making it an irresistible draw for thousands of attendees seeking international travel deals.

Ultimate Visitor Logistics

To ensure an absolutely smooth, stress-free, and thoroughly enjoyable visitor experience, the organisers have meticulously planned the logistics of the event.

MATTA Fair proudly offers completely free admission to all members of the public, entirely removing any barriers to entry and ensuring that the joy of travel planning is available to everyone.

The doors are open for an extensive 11 hours daily, operating from 10 am to 9 pm, spanning from Friday all the way through to Sunday. This generous timeframe allows working professionals, busy parents, and eager students ample opportunity to explore the halls at their absolute convenience.

Recognising the immense popularity of the event and the potential for heavy vehicular traffic, the organisers enthusiastically encourage all visitors to take full advantage of the highly efficient, complimentary shuttle services.

These dedicated shuttles operate seamlessly from key transit hubs, specifically KL Sentral and Sunway Putra Mall, offering a direct, air-conditioned, and completely free ride straight to the magnificent MITEC venue. This thoughtful transportation strategy not only massively reduces carbon emissions but also entirely eliminates the stress of navigating peak-hour traffic.

Comprehensive Parking Solutions

For those who absolutely must travel by private vehicle, a remarkably comprehensive and highly organised parking infrastructure has been established.

Parking facilities are abundantly available at the stunning South Entrance basement right inside MITEC, providing the ultimate convenience for early arrivals.

Understanding that this premium space fills up rapidly, an extensive network of overflow parking locations has been officially secured.

Visitors can confidently utilise the enormous MATRADE open parking area, the highly secure MITI basement, and the ultra-modern MET Corporate Tower.

Furthermore, additional spaces are readily available at the stylish MET Galleria, the expansive Courts Complex KL open parking, and the luxurious Hyatt Regency basement parking.
